San Nicola Arcella is a picturesque seaside town in Calabria, located in the province of Cosenza on the Tyrrhenian Sea. It is known for its dramatic rocky landscape and spectacular views of the coastline. The biggest attraction is the famous Arco Magno rock arch, a natural cave with a small beach accessible on foot or by boat. The surrounding beaches have fine sand and clear water, ideal for swimming and diving. The town offers a traditional Calabrian atmosphere with narrow streets and stone houses. There are many restaurants serving seafood and regional specialities. San Nicola Arcella is also a good starting point for trips to Pollino National Park. The climate is Mediterranean, with hot summers and mild winters.
